Control and Variational Inequalities

10:30 AM-12:30 PM
Tampa 1st Floor

The speakers in this minisymposium will address recent advances in control problems involving variational inequalities. Typical problems include application of controls to a variational inequality to achieve the minimization of a desired objective functional, or a variational inequality that may arise in the optimality conditions for an optimal control problem for partial differential equations.
